Output dc59f6de300d35ce568b6b37c6d661d93d0c42fcff4f9c6eefbf59a3e92a54d4:1

value
187571483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c5e6bc3268fce85f277a20a6aa96136d03e2ff0 OP_EQUAL
address
MLhMwmYaLFg67cHW468FAvGWqkVuDt9u8B
transaction
dc59f6de300d35ce568b6b37c6d661d93d0c42fcff4f9c6eefbf59a3e92a54d4
spent
true